About Brighton 3186

The size of Brighton is approximately 8.4 square kilometres. It has 22 parks covering nearly 10.9% of total area. The population of Brighton in 2011 was 21,257 people. By 2016 the population was 23,248 showing a population growth of 9.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Brighton is 50-59 years. Households in Brighton are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Brighton work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 73.4% of the homes in Brighton were owner-occupied compared with 72.1% in 2016.

Brighton has 13,686 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Brighton have seen a 31.89%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 11.30%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Brighton is $3,367,092 while the median value for Units is $1,156,012.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,400 while Units have a median rent of $799.
